SYMPTOMS
When you log off from a session where you used Kerberos credentials on a computer that runs Windows 2000, an access violation may occur in Lsass.exe.
CAUSE
This behavior occurs if only one of the two handles that are related to Kerberos credentials is closed. The Kerberos credentials are purged in one of the handles. The credentials are then purged again in the other handle, which causes the access violation.
RESOLUTION
To resolve this problem, obtain the latest service pack for Windows 2000. For additional information, click the following article number to view the article in the Microsoft Knowledge Base:
260910 How to Obtain the Latest Windows 2000 Service Pack
This fix should be applied to both server and client systems that run Windows 2000.

STATUS
Microsoft has confirmed that this is a problem in the Microsoft products that are listed at the beginning of this article. This problem was first corrected in Windows 2000 Service Pack 3.
